Getting Ready Tips

Let’s go over a few different tips that you can use if you’re going to be getting ready for your wedding day soon. As always, it’s important to think about your individual situation and make sure that you’re taking into account any individual factors that may need to be addressed.

Schedule Time

One of the most important things you can do when it comes to planning your wedding day is making sure that you have enough time scheduled. Some people underestimate how much time it’ll take them to get ready. If you don’t plan enough time, you could end up feeling rushed or having to make compromises. Because of this, it’s best to make sure that you have enough time scheduled in your day for every step of the getting ready process.

Coordinating Professionals

Another important thing to think about is coordinating the professionals you’ll be working with. If you’re having someone do your hair and another professional do your makeup, then you’ll need to be sure that they both have enough time to work their magic.

Consider coordinating with all of the professionals you’re going to be working with before your big day, so that everyone is on the same page and is sure that they’ll have the right amount of time that’s needed for their individual services.

Make an Emergency Kit

Are you planning on making an emergency kit for your big day? If you are, then make sure that you include things you’ll need to get ready. Consider packing some extra deodorant, safety pins, and other things you’ll need to make sure that your outfit comes together perfectly.

Helping Hands

If there are people you can ask to help you get ready you should do it.

 

Having enough people there is important, as you’ll need help getting into your outfit and making sure that everything goes smoothly. Keep in mind that you’ll most likely also have your bridal party getting ready at the same time, so you may want to ask someone who’s not in the wedding for help.
